  • 400 GbE cable supports higher bandwidths needed for next-gen data and voice networking
    As the amount of traffic in data networks grows, so does the need for next-generation devices and fiber cables to support much higher bandwidths in cloud services, hyperscale data centers, telecom applications and equipment OEM companies. This multimode 50/125 OM4 breakout cable is an ideal choice for 400G Ethernet applications up to 100 meters (at 850 nm). It has documented insertion loss and back reflection testing on every connector and attenuation loss that meets or exceeds current standards.
  • 16-fiber MTP/MPO connector designed for the QSFP-DD transceivers
    The MPO connector has a wide parallel optical interface for use with the 400G QSFP-DD transceivers, making this cable an excellent solution for your high-density network application. The MPO connector is the same size as a standard SC connector, but 12 times denser, allowing vertical stacking in switches or patch panels where space is at a premium. Pull tabs make the cable easy to install or remove with one hand. The LC duplex connectors are recommended for high-density feed-through cassettes with no splicing required.
  • Jacket helps avoid misidentification that can cause costly downtime
    The OM4-rated cable has a jacket, which is easy to identify quickly in a crowded patch panel or switch and helps prevent the cable from becoming accidentally disconnected. The three-millimeter ruggedized plenum-rated jacket has low smoke and flame characteristics, making it suitable for premise applications in ceilings, walls, and ducts.

Support Higher Bandwidths in Data Networks with OM4 Multimode 50/125 Fiber Patch Cable
As the amount of traffic in data networks grows, so does the need for next generation devices and fiber cables to support much higher bandwidths. Tripp Lite's 3-meter N846D-03M-24CAQ MTP/MPO Multimode Fiber Breakout Cable is designed to support the next generation of 400G QSFP-DD transceivers. The 24F MTP/MPO-PC Female to (x8) LC Duplex-PC Male OM4-rated multimode fiber optic breakout cable is recommended for high-density fiber patching between data center MDFs (main distribution frames) and IDFs (intermediate distribution frames). It's colored aqua for instant identification as an OM4 cable. This cable is also backwards compatible with QSFP+ and QSFP28 modules.
Experience Reliable Performance with Premium Construction
Premium materials ensure this multimode fiber cable reliably carries data and voice signals. The 16-fiber MTP/MPO connectors are about the same size as SC connectors, but are 12 times denser, freeing up rack space for other cables. Optimized for QSFP-DD networks, this cable is tested for low insertion loss and back reflection on every connector and attenuation loss that meets or exceeds current standards. The N846D-03M-24CAQ features a 3.0-millimeter ruggedized plenum-rated jacket that has low smoke and flame characteristics. Making this cable perfect for connecting high-speed network components in ceilings, walls and ducts.
